Table A 3 . Run list and instrumentation settings .
Hub Excitation Excitation Run Description Azimuth Signal Type Frequency Amplitude Window (deg) (Hz) (lb) IP000 – 49.2 Burst Random 0 – 80 800 None IP000 - 200 – 49.2 Burst Random 0 – 80 600 None IP270 – 139.9 Thump Random 0 – 80 Undocumented Undocumented IP270 - 200 – 139.9 Thump Random 0 – 80 Undocumented Undocumented IP315 – 95.1 Thump Random 0 – 80 400 Hanning Broad IP315 - 200 – 95.1 Thump Random 0 – 80 800 Hanning Broad IP50 0 Thump Random 0 – 80 600 Hanning Broad IP50 - 200 0 Thump Random 0 – 80 400 Hanning Broad VTC – 4.31 Pseudo - random 0 – 100 Undocumented Hanning Broad VTC - 200 – 4.31 Pseudo - random 0 – 100 Undocumented Hanning Broad VT000 – 4.31 Pseudo - random 0 – 100 Undocumented Hanning Broad VT000 - 200 – 4.31 Pseudo - random 0 – 100 Undocumented Hanning Broad VT270 – 4.31 Pseudo - random 0 – 100 Undocumented Undocumented VT270 - 200 – 4.31 Pseudo - random 0 – 100 Undocumented Undocumented VT315 – 4.31 Pseudo - random 0 – 100 Undocumented Undocumented VT315 - 200 – 4.31 Pseudo - random 0 – 100 Undocumented Undocumented 9 IP270 - A10 – 139.7 Pseudo - random 0 – 100 400 Hanning Broad 10 IP270NVP – 139.7 Pseudo - random 0 – 100 400 Hanning Broad 11 IP000NVP – 49.2 Pseudo - random 0 – 100 Undocumented Undocumented 1.
IP is in - plane; VT is vertical shaking. Number indicates azimuth of shaker location. Input load is positive in tension (i.e., towards the reaction mass).
2.
– 200 indicates additional 200 lb of weight present on the shake plate.
3.
VTC is vertical shaking on center.
4.
– A10 indicates shaking at an alpha of – 10 deg.
5.
NVP indicates vertical shake plate not present.
